816 Day 2021: “PLUG-GED IN” Peace, Love, Unity, Greatness

The HISTORIC 18th & Vine Jazz District in Kansas City, Missouri is home to some of the greatest legends of jazz and baseball such as Charlie Parker, Count Basie, Lester Young, George and Julie Lee, Satchel Paige, James “Cool Papa” Bell, and Josh Gibson.
